Embedded Systems Ingenieur ? Entwicklung von Hard- & Softwarelösungen für anspruchsvolle Projekte"
Aktualisiert am 12.03.2025
Profil
Freiberufler / Selbstständiger
Remote-Arbeit
Verfügbar ab: 15.03.2025
Verfügbar zu: 100%
davon vor Ort: 100%
Embedded System
Firmware Development (C/C++)
Project Management
Microcontroller Programming
Embedded Software Architecture
Real-Time Operating Systems
Hardware Prototyping
Signal Processing
Communication Protocols
Debugging & Hardware Testing
MATLAB/Simulink
Secure Firmware
CI/CD
Industrial Automation
Software Version Control
Python for Data Processing
Deutsch
Muttersprache
Englisch
fließend

Einsatzorte

Einsatzorte

Berlin (+200km)
Deutschland
möglich

Projekte

Projekte

2 Jahre 6 Monate
2022-05 - 2024-10

Projektleitung und Softwareentwicklung

elektronische Schlösser (ABUS):
  • Projektleitung:
    • Verantwortlich für die Koordination des gesamten Projektzyklus.
  • Softwareentwicklung (ARM Cortex M4):
    • Entwicklung und Implementierung von Embedded Software für Sicherheitsschlösser, einschließlich motorischer Steuerung und kryptographischer Sicherheitsmaßnahmen.
  • Hardwaretests:
    • Durchführung von Tests und Auswahl geeigneter Mikrocontroller und Komponenten.
  • Systementwicklung für die Endfertigung:
    • Konzeption und Implementierung von Programmierungs- und Testsystemen für den Produktionsabschluss.


Landwirtschaftsmaschinen (John Deere):

  • Entwicklung und Verifikation von Regelungssoftware für Einspritzsysteme in Feldhäckslern.
  • Entwicklung der Regelungslogik in MATLAB/Simulink
  • Integration von generiertem C-Code in Embedded-Umgebung der Steuergeräte
  • Planung und Aufbau von Prüfständen zur Simulation der Maschinensysteme.


Passagiertransportsysteme:

  • Entwicklung von Automatisierungstests für Passagierzählsysteme.
  • Einsatz von Robot Framework für die Testautomatisierung.


Automobilindustrie:

  • Softwareentwicklung:
    • Entwicklung von Modulen in C++ für Embedded Linux-basierte Steuergeräte.
  • Systemkonfiguration und Systemtests:
    • Mitarbeit bei der Konfiguration und dem Test der Steuergeräte.

comlet Distributed Systems GmbH
Zweibrücken
2 Jahre 2 Monate
2020-03 - 2022-04

Implementierung von Algorithmen

Studentischer Mitarbeiter Python Datenanalyse Maschinelles Lernen
Studentischer Mitarbeiter
  • Implementierung von Algorithmen zur Auswertung von Messdaten, unter anderem mit Verfahren des maschinellen Lernens
  • Auswertung von 3D-Scans zur Oberflächenbestimmung von Bauteilen in Python
Python Datenanalyse Maschinelles Lernen
Fraunhofer IZFP
Saarbrücken
2 Jahre 6 Monate
2019-05 - 2021-10

Entwicklung eines mikromagnetischen Messsystems

Embedded Entwickler
Embedded Entwickler
  • Entwicklung eines Hardwareprototyps zur Verarbeitung von Sensordaten
  • Implementierung eines Embedded Systems (ARM Cortex M7)
  • Nutzung von FreeRTOS für Echtzeitverarbeitung
Echtzeitbetriebssystem Sensorik Mikrocontrollerprogrammierung
5 Monate
2015-05 - 2015-09

SPS-Programmierung für Automatisierungslösungen

Inbetriebnahmetechniker
Inbetriebnahmetechniker
  • Verdrahten von Schaltschränken und Durchführen von Umbaumaßnahmen
  • Inbetriebnahme und Instandhaltung von HVAC-Regelungen und Industrieanlagen in der Gebäudeautomatisierung
Sauter Cumulus GmbH
Saarlouis

Aus- und Weiterbildung

Aus- und Weiterbildung

2 Jahre 6 Monate
2019-05 - 2021-10

Masterstudium Elektro- und Informationstechnik

Master of Science (Note 1.1), Hochschule für Technik und Wirtschaft des Saarlandes, Saarbrücken
Master of Science (Note 1.1)
Hochschule für Technik und Wirtschaft des Saarlandes, Saarbrücken

Masterthesis, Fraunhofer IZFP Saarbrücken (Thema auf Anfrage)



3 Jahre 7 Monate
2015-10 - 2019-04

Bachelorstudium Elektro- und Informationstechnik

Bachelor of Engineering (Note: 1.8), Hochschule für Technik und Wirtschaft des Saarlandes, Saarbrücken
Bachelor of Engineering (Note: 1.8)
Hochschule für Technik und Wirtschaft des Saarlandes, Saarbrücken
Praktische Studienphase und Bachelorthesis, Sauter AG Basel (Thema auf Anfrage)
2 Jahre 8 Monate
2012-09 - 2015-04

Berufsausbildung zum Elektroniker für Automatisierungstechnik

Sauter Cumulus GmbH, Saarlouis
Sauter Cumulus GmbH, Saarlouis
  • SPS-Programmierung und Inbetriebnahme von Industrieanlagen
  • Verdrahtung und Wartung von Schaltschränken
  • Automatisierungstechnik für die industrielle Gebäudeautomation

Kompetenzen

Kompetenzen

Top-Skills

Embedded System Firmware Development (C/C++) Project Management Microcontroller Programming Embedded Software Architecture Real-Time Operating Systems Hardware Prototyping Signal Processing Communication Protocols Debugging & Hardware Testing MATLAB/Simulink Secure Firmware CI/CD Industrial Automation Software Version Control Python for Data Processing

Produkte / Standards / Erfahrungen / Methoden

Kenntnisse

Versionskontrolle

  • Git
  • SVN


Bussysteme

  • CAN (SAE J1939, CANopen, CAN FD)
  • I2C
  • SPI
  • UART


Debugging-Tools

  • JTAG
  • SWD
  • Logic Analyzer


ECAD-Tools & Hardware

  • Schaltplandesign
  • PCB-Layout mit Autodesk EAGLE
  • KiCad


Softwaretests

  • Testfallentwicklung
  • Unit Testing
  • Robot Framework
  • CI/CD


Simulationstools

  • LTspice
  • LabVIEW


Sicherheit

  • Spezifizierung und Implementierung kryptographischer Konzepte


Projektmanagement

  • Führung und Management von Softwareentwicklungsprojekten

Betriebssysteme

Linux
inkl. Embedded Linux
Windows
FreeRTOS
Zephyr



Programmiersprachen

C, C++
Python
MATLAB/Simulink
VHDL
SPS-Programmierung


Einsatzorte

Einsatzorte

Berlin (+200km)
Deutschland
möglich

Projekte

Projekte

2 Jahre 6 Monate
2022-05 - 2024-10

Projektleitung und Softwareentwicklung

elektronische Schlösser (ABUS):
  • Projektleitung:
    • Verantwortlich für die Koordination des gesamten Projektzyklus.
  • Softwareentwicklung (ARM Cortex M4):
    • Entwicklung und Implementierung von Embedded Software für Sicherheitsschlösser, einschließlich motorischer Steuerung und kryptographischer Sicherheitsmaßnahmen.
  • Hardwaretests:
    • Durchführung von Tests und Auswahl geeigneter Mikrocontroller und Komponenten.
  • Systementwicklung für die Endfertigung:
    • Konzeption und Implementierung von Programmierungs- und Testsystemen für den Produktionsabschluss.


Landwirtschaftsmaschinen (John Deere):

  • Entwicklung und Verifikation von Regelungssoftware für Einspritzsysteme in Feldhäckslern.
  • Entwicklung der Regelungslogik in MATLAB/Simulink
  • Integration von generiertem C-Code in Embedded-Umgebung der Steuergeräte
  • Planung und Aufbau von Prüfständen zur Simulation der Maschinensysteme.


Passagiertransportsysteme:

  • Entwicklung von Automatisierungstests für Passagierzählsysteme.
  • Einsatz von Robot Framework für die Testautomatisierung.


Automobilindustrie:

  • Softwareentwicklung:
    • Entwicklung von Modulen in C++ für Embedded Linux-basierte Steuergeräte.
  • Systemkonfiguration und Systemtests:
    • Mitarbeit bei der Konfiguration und dem Test der Steuergeräte.

comlet Distributed Systems GmbH
Zweibrücken
2 Jahre 2 Monate
2020-03 - 2022-04

Implementierung von Algorithmen

Studentischer Mitarbeiter Python Datenanalyse Maschinelles Lernen
Studentischer Mitarbeiter
  • Implementierung von Algorithmen zur Auswertung von Messdaten, unter anderem mit Verfahren des maschinellen Lernens
  • Auswertung von 3D-Scans zur Oberflächenbestimmung von Bauteilen in Python
Python Datenanalyse Maschinelles Lernen
Fraunhofer IZFP
Saarbrücken
2 Jahre 6 Monate
2019-05 - 2021-10

Entwicklung eines mikromagnetischen Messsystems

Embedded Entwickler
Embedded Entwickler
  • Entwicklung eines Hardwareprototyps zur Verarbeitung von Sensordaten
  • Implementierung eines Embedded Systems (ARM Cortex M7)
  • Nutzung von FreeRTOS für Echtzeitverarbeitung
Echtzeitbetriebssystem Sensorik Mikrocontrollerprogrammierung
5 Monate
2015-05 - 2015-09

SPS-Programmierung für Automatisierungslösungen

Inbetriebnahmetechniker
Inbetriebnahmetechniker
  • Verdrahten von Schaltschränken und Durchführen von Umbaumaßnahmen
  • Inbetriebnahme und Instandhaltung von HVAC-Regelungen und Industrieanlagen in der Gebäudeautomatisierung
Sauter Cumulus GmbH
Saarlouis

Aus- und Weiterbildung

Aus- und Weiterbildung

2 Jahre 6 Monate
2019-05 - 2021-10

Masterstudium Elektro- und Informationstechnik

Master of Science (Note 1.1), Hochschule für Technik und Wirtschaft des Saarlandes, Saarbrücken
Master of Science (Note 1.1)
Hochschule für Technik und Wirtschaft des Saarlandes, Saarbrücken

Masterthesis, Fraunhofer IZFP Saarbrücken (Thema auf Anfrage)



3 Jahre 7 Monate
2015-10 - 2019-04

Bachelorstudium Elektro- und Informationstechnik

Bachelor of Engineering (Note: 1.8), Hochschule für Technik und Wirtschaft des Saarlandes, Saarbrücken
Bachelor of Engineering (Note: 1.8)
Hochschule für Technik und Wirtschaft des Saarlandes, Saarbrücken
Praktische Studienphase und Bachelorthesis, Sauter AG Basel (Thema auf Anfrage)
2 Jahre 8 Monate
2012-09 - 2015-04

Berufsausbildung zum Elektroniker für Automatisierungstechnik

Sauter Cumulus GmbH, Saarlouis
Sauter Cumulus GmbH, Saarlouis
  • SPS-Programmierung und Inbetriebnahme von Industrieanlagen
  • Verdrahtung und Wartung von Schaltschränken
  • Automatisierungstechnik für die industrielle Gebäudeautomation

Kompetenzen

Kompetenzen

Top-Skills

Embedded System Firmware Development (C/C++) Project Management Microcontroller Programming Embedded Software Architecture Real-Time Operating Systems Hardware Prototyping Signal Processing Communication Protocols Debugging & Hardware Testing MATLAB/Simulink Secure Firmware CI/CD Industrial Automation Software Version Control Python for Data Processing

Produkte / Standards / Erfahrungen / Methoden

Kenntnisse

Versionskontrolle

  • Git
  • SVN


Bussysteme

  • CAN (SAE J1939, CANopen, CAN FD)
  • I2C
  • SPI
  • UART


Debugging-Tools

  • JTAG
  • SWD
  • Logic Analyzer


ECAD-Tools & Hardware

  • Schaltplandesign
  • PCB-Layout mit Autodesk EAGLE
  • KiCad


Softwaretests

  • Testfallentwicklung
  • Unit Testing
  • Robot Framework
  • CI/CD


Simulationstools

  • LTspice
  • LabVIEW


Sicherheit

  • Spezifizierung und Implementierung kryptographischer Konzepte


Projektmanagement

  • Führung und Management von Softwareentwicklungsprojekten

Betriebssysteme

Linux
inkl. Embedded Linux
Windows
FreeRTOS
Zephyr



Programmiersprachen

C, C++
Python
MATLAB/Simulink
VHDL
SPS-Programmierung


Vertrauen Sie auf Randstad

Im Bereich Freelancing
Im Bereich Arbeitnehmerüberlassung / Personalvermittlung

Fragen?

Rufen Sie uns an +49 89 500316-300 oder schreiben Sie uns:

Das Freelancer-Portal

Direktester geht's nicht! Ganz einfach Freelancer finden und direkt Kontakt aufnehmen.